Rob Kardashian made a statement on social media in support of his ex-girlfriend, Rita Ora.

Things have been tense between Rob Kardashian and Rita Ora since their split in 2012. There was some pretty bad blood after he decided to trash her on social media and in reports. Kardashian began his journey to gaining weight while the two were dating and blamed it on Ora. He reportedly gained 40 pounds while they were together after she cheated on him.

Everything played out in 2013, including Rob Kardashian ignoring his sisters’ advice about not blasting Rita Ora on social media. He did it then and clearly didn’t learn anything because he did the same with Blac Chyna in 2017.

Rita Ora is under fire over the lyrics to her new song, Girls. It talks about having relationships with girls and men, which has caused some backlash. Critics have called Ora out, which prompted her to issue an apology and admit that she was just living her truth. She has been in relationships with both men and women.

Swooping in to show support, Rob Kardashian quoted her tweet and threw up the praise emoji. This was shocking for fans who know the two had some serious bad blood. Although it appears there are no longer hard feelings, Kardashian supporting his ex isn’t shocking at this point.
